U.S. News & World Report Names Nine Children’s of Alabama Programs to Best Children’s Hospitals List

U.S. News & World Report has named nine pediatric specialty services at Children’s of Alabama among the nation’s best children’s hospitals for 2021-22.

This is the 12th consecutive year that Children’s has participated in the program and 12th consecutive year to be included in the rankings among the best children’s hospitals in the nation. This is also the first year U.S. News & World Report has ranked hospitals by state and region. Children’s ranked as the top hospital in Alabama for children and tied for third in the southeast region. Children’s and the University of Alabama at Birmingham (UAB) Departments of Pediatrics and Surgery collaborated to submit the requested information. Children’s is the primary site for pediatric clinical and educational programs for the UAB School of Medicine. Children’s has provided specialized medical care for ill and injured children since 1911, offering inpatient and outpatient services throughout Central Alabama.

U.S. News & World Report introduced the Best Children’s Hospitals rankings in 2007 to help families of sick children find the best medical care available. Children’s and UAB began participating in the pediatric rankings in 2011.
